On Benefits (De Beneficiis)

On Benefits (De Beneficiis) is a moral essay written by the Roman philosopher Seneca in the 1st century CE. It explores Stoic ethics, particularly focusing on the dynamics of political leadership and the complexities surrounding the giving and receiving of gifts and favors in society. The work is notable for its examination of moral philosophy in the context of interpersonal relationships and civic duty, making it a significant contribution to Stoic literature.
